• The course focuses on the application of the Poka Yoke (mistake-proofing or inadvertent error prevention) methodology integrated with modern smart manufacturing tools, specifically the Pick-to-Light (PTL) system. It serves as a training and simulation framework designed to teach employees how to eliminate human errors, shorten assembly times, streamline production workflows, and achieve a "zero error rate" in component assembly (demonstrated using a model 3D printer extruder with a motor).
